Grok Bot Manages 5 Businesses: Autonomously Operates Websites and Apps
PrajwalTomar_ · x · 2026-08-21
The author shares a hands-on experience of using Grok Bot to manage five businesses. The AI agent autonomously operates the computer to log into apps, uses websites exactly like a human, conducts end-to-end product testing, researches clients while the author sleeps, and drafts content in their style. It reportedly learns workflows after observing them just once. The setup took only one evening, and the agent only pings the author when a decision is needed.
